Above-ground bomb shelters and bunkers are feasible with the right considerations. An effective system would include air filtration and a positive pressure mechanism. Nuclear fallout primarily consists of relatively large particles that can be filtered out using standard HEPA filters and industrial air filtration devices available on the market. In fact, even the military sometimes constructs bomb and fallout shelters that are mostly above ground. In the worst-case scenario, you would likely need to stay in a shelter for only a couple of weeks before it becomes relatively safe to venture outside. The radiation from a nuclear bomb diminishes rapidly as the shorter-lived, more dangerous radioisotopes decay.

The most significant practical challenge is ensuring that your filters and air pumps are independent of the power grid. Professional fallout shelters often use hand-cranked filters that provide positive pressure and air filtration. These can be readily obtained. Positive pressure is crucial to ensure that the only air entering the shelter is filtered air. Naturally, the shelter must be as airtight as possible. It is also essential to have adequate firefighting equipment to address potential fires caused by the explosion or other sources.

Due to the shockwave generated by the blast, glass windows are likely to shatter. To prevent this, one effective method is to securely board up the windows, similar to preparations made during a hurricane. Reinforced shutters made of metal would be the optimal choice. Wood has a tendency to burn, which poses a risk in a nuclear explosion due to the light emissions.

A converted shipping container can serve as an excellent fallout or bomb shelter. Digging a pit, placing the container inside, and covering it with a few feet of soil can create a suitable setup. Once you install air filtration, you will be well-prepared. Such a setup would be on par with professional military shelters, as this is often their approach for locations not expected to be directly hit by a nuclear bomb. Adding a couple of feet of soil on top is crucial because radiation can penetrate thin metal, potentially increasing its potency. The soil would help mitigate bremsstrahlung radiation. Additionally, it is essential to waterproof the container from the outside to prevent rotting and leakage.
